About

Holes 18
Type Public
Style Desert/Traditional
Par 72
Length 6716 yards
Slope 135
Rating 72.1

Located a short distance from Sky Harbor Airport in Phoenix and Arizona State University, Kokopelli Golf Course is a championship length course that offers many interesting challenges. The rolling terrain creates sloping greens and undulating fairways. A majority of the teeboxes and greens are elevated as well. The course also has large multiple island tees and water hazards in the form of meandering lakes that come into play on several holes. The signature hole of Kokopelli Golf Course is the par-5 18th hole. The dramatic finishing hole calls for a shot off an elevated too followed by an approach shot past water to an elevated green.

Perfect weather
Used cart

Wear your water proof golf boots.

I actually love this course. It is a beautiful layout with a lot to offer visually. The holes provide some challenges but it is not unfairly set up. My issue is with the water retention, especially what is now the front nine. I can't get through the round without taking my shoes off at least twice to get the mud off of them. I usually play in the morning and I guess its shortly after the irrigation has been running but the lack of grass next to and around the golf path ensures that you almost always have to walk through the mud to get to your ball or the green. Plus the Sand Traps are an automatic free drop. They are just unplayable.

Having said that, the tee's and Greens are always in great shape. I think they are some of the best greens in the valley.

Unfortunately, I think it will take major renovations to build in proper drainage and seed grass in all the places that needs it. I go to Kokopelli when I want to get in a quick round. However, when I want to have a great golf experience, I look elsewhere.

Hiring Greenskeeper???

Played this course November 2021 and looked forward to returning this past weekend May 2022.

Unfortunately, it seems as though the entire greenskeeper team has been on vacation since I played there 6 months ago in November. Mud and standing water in the cart paths. No full grass across any fairway or tee box. Anthills and dirt patches on the greens. Also, impossible to play out of sand traps as they are either muddy or have standing water.

Sad to see an ARCIS course in this kind of condition. Charging $70 to play a course in this bad of shape without warning, they should be charged with fraud.
